Hi everyone,
has anyone come across the following and is willing to share the solution?
we have a very strange problem with our HP Color Laserjet MFP M277dw printer, when setting configuration for the "Scan to Folder" functionality.
The printer does work as a network printer and i can browse to its web interface.
What it IS REFUSING TO do is to accept the login details so that it scans -as PDF - onto a network folder.
We have a dedicated account for this; it has permissions to the scan area:
1. test from the web interface fails;
2. when attempting a scan on the device, it fails too.
A. I then try my network account - which has unrestricted access - and again both attempts fail.
B. I have to type both passwords on notepad (to make sure i am typing either password correctly) paste onto the password box, and.. nothing..
C. Tried changing the IP address for a network path and nothing..
D. Tried switching back to network path.. nothing..
E. i then try to use both accounts to log into a computer and i can get in, and even browse to the required scan area but when i try to use either network account, i cannot scan..
F. I am now losing the will to live..
Please can anyone help us solve this conundrum?

Here are the steps to Set Up the 'Scan to Network Folder'.
Please check if you have followed it correctly.
- Create/Select a folder on the computer to save the scanned documents.
- Right click on the folder and select properties
- Go to Sharing Tab > Advanced Sharing
- Select the checkbox 'Share this Folder'
- At the bottom of advanced sharing, click on permissions and give full access/full control
- Obtain the IP address on the printer by pressing the WiFi/Ethernet icon on the printer control panel.
- Open a web browser and Type the IP address into the Internet browser address line, and then press Enter to open the printer EWS.
- EWS page Opens.
- Go to Scan > Scan to Network Folder Set UP
- Select New
- Enter the display name and the Network path of the folder
- To obtain the Network path of the folder, right click on the folder > properties > Sharing
- It displays the network path
- Click next
- Enter the username and password for the computer
- create a security pin(optional)
- click Save and Test
Note:
- If you are in a work environment, enter the 'Domain name' and '/' followed by the username of the PC.
- In the Network path, use the complete IP address and the folder path correctly.
- Ensure that SMB1.0/CIFS File Sharing Support is checked
- Open Control Panel.
- Click on Programs.
-
Click on 'Turn Windows features on or off' link.
-
This generates a list of features. make sure SMB1.0/CIFS File Sharing Support feature is checked
